The only difference is that the ‘shiny new’ PlayStation ports seem to be receiving some kind of active support from Activision. Because Black Ops has disabled some of its playlists while the “issues” are investigated.
The problem is simple: hackers. Do you believe Black ops 7 Does it have a bad reputation for hackers? Without modern anti-cheat technologies, old games are like the Wild West.
📢 Call of Duty: #BlackOps on PS4/PS5. Some playlists have been disabled while we investigate the reported issues.July 13, 2026
It didn’t take long for the new ports to be compromised, which really shows how lazy they are. We’re not just talking about wallhacks either, although they are pretty bad.
Players are inundated with rooms full of players performing feats. Some get max prestige instantly, everything unlocked, ridiculous stats, and perhaps worst of all for legit players, a “negative XP” cheat has been reported to be causing players to revert to level 1.
